Request for Qualifications — Falmouth Public Schools - MA RFQ 2026

Falmouth Public Schools, Massachusetts. Energy Management Services – Decarbonization and Electrification Project Falmouth Public Schools issues an RFQ pursuant to 225 CMR 19.00 from qualified firms interested in implementing a comprehensive. Open — accepting responses.

About this solicitation

Energy Management Services – Decarbonization and Electrification Project Falmouth Public Schools issues an RFQ pursuant to 225 CMR 19.00 from qualified firms interested in implementing a comprehensive, performance-based Ene ... Published in Falmouth Enterprise, The.

Bid summary

Falmouth Public Schools issued this consulting opportunity in Massachusetts. It was published on May 8, 2026.
